PET Scans
Imaging tests that allow doctors to check for diseases in the body by injecting a radioactive substance to show activity and function of tissues and organs.
Sympathetic System
Part of the autonomic nervous system that activates what is often termed the fight or flight response, preparing the body for rapid action in response to a perceived threat.
Parasympathetic System
controls homeostasis and the body at rest and is responsible for the body's "rest and digest" response.
CNS
The central nervous system, comprising the brain and spinal cord, responsible for integrating sensory information and responding accordingly.
